Most … WebStriped bass (Roccus saxatilis) add a dimension to surf fishing that can only be described as incredible. These raucous rogues rampage in the surf from the Coquille River northward to the Siuslaw River, but the best fishing is to be found on the beach at Bastendorff Beach, North Beach and Horsefall Beach. Call Captain Andy Martin • 541.813.1082 / … WebMar 11, 2024 · The Crooked River is best fished in the Tailwater section from Bowman Dam back downstream towards Prineville to Mile Marker 12. This 8 mile stretch of river is the best section of water to fly fish. There are also limited opportunities to fish the Crooked River near Smith Rock State Park and near Opal Springs.
